Students who wish to get a BA LLB seat at MJPRU must follow the below-mentioned steps:1. Check the eligibility criteria. Only those who meet the eligibility criteria are considered for the selection process.2. If eligible, apply for the course on the official website.3. After the application process, the university releases the merit list based on the qualifying examination.4. Based on this list, the seats are allocated. Those who get a seat must report to the institute.5. Lastly, they must pay the admission fee to confirm the seat.

Document verification is an important part of the admission process. In this process, the students who are offered final admissions must report to the institute along with the listed below documents:Class 10 marksheetClass 12 marksheetMigration certificateSchool leaving certificate/transfer certificateCategory certificate (if applicable)Income certificate (applicable for candidates seeking admission via EWS category)

The first step to get admission to the MJPRU BA LLB course is to fill out the application form. It can be accessed by visiting the official website of the university. The steps to fill out the form are listed below:1. Go to the official website of the university’s admission portal.2. Locate and click on the ‘New Registration’ banner.3. Register by filling out the asked details.4. Login and fill out the available application form.5. Upload scanned documents.6. Pay the application fee and submit the form.

Students who are willing to take admission in BA LLB courses at MJPRU are required to fulfill the minimum eligibility requirements. As per the official website, to be eligible, a candidate must have completed Class 12 with minimum marks of 45% (for the general category) and 40% (for the SC/ST category) in aggregate. Only those who are eligible are considered for further admission.

The fee structure of MJPRU BA LLB course includes various components such as tuition fees, examination fees, training fees, etc. As per the structure, the total tuition fee is INR 1 lakh to INR 2.8 lakh. To know the other fees, candidates are advised to visit the official website of the university.Note: The above-mentioned fee is as per the official sources. However, it is indicative and subject to change.

The total fee for the LLB program at Dr D.Y. Patil Law College is approximately INR 1,00,000 for the entire course. The annual fee is about INR 29,000 in the first year of the course. The fee structure is considered affordable compared to other law colleges in India. The fee may vary based on the course.

There are various job opportunities for candidates after completing BBA LLB (Hons) from the Sharda University, School of Law. The degree holders can find good job opportunities in corporate sector and business firms. There are good career opportunities in planning, administration, management, and industrial sector in addition to the judiciary & legal profession. Some of the popular job roles for BBA LLB graduates in the private sector are: Business ConsultantAssistant AdvisoryAttorney GeneralFinance ManagerHuman Resource ManagerHuman Resource ManagerCompany Secretary
